They're also a very young team that needs to learn to make adjustments, otherwise this slump will never end. Last season, I noticed Mike n Logan would have stretches of great ABs and crappy ABs. This year, pitchers know their weaknesses much more than last year, and they're exploiting them greatly. What's the scouting report on Stanton? Breaking balls. And throw in fastballs down the middle basically to throw him off. Maybe he has a pattern of take-swing on first pitches in ABs and pitchers know that. Take last night. One AB he took a first pitch breaking ball for a ball, the count got to 3-0 before he flew out on a 3-1 I believe. Next AB he swung at three in the dirt. He almost goes from passive hitter to aggressive hitter and switches back each at bat. When he learns to have the same approach every AB, we'll see consistency from him.

 

As for Logan ... I just don't know.

The offense seems to be what has been crippling the Marlins as of late. There's been several games where they have scored only 0, 1, or 2 runs. Some of that is on Hanley because he's supposed to be the best hitter and anchor of that lineup, however the rest of the lineup is pretty much a patchwork of either 1st/2nd year players who are going to have their slumps (Morrison, Stanton, Sanchez), guys that Beinfest overestimated (Infante, Buck), or bench/AAAA players who are being designated with a larger role than they should be (Dobbs, Bonifacio, Lopez, Wise, etc.).

 

Even if Hanley OPSes .950, this team is not a contender. It's hard to blame Beinfest too much though; a lot of it has to do with Morrison, Stanton, and Sanchez slowing down almost at the same instant. That's sort of a nightmare scenario that's hard to prevent and circumvent, especially for a team with the Marlins' payroll.

I'd like to see Loria crack open the wallet a bit....but honestly it has to a lot decisions backfiring For instance, the Miguel Cabrera trade was a complete disaster. Sure, it was unlikely that both Maybin and Miller would be utter failures, but it happened. We gave up one of the best players in baseball and got nothing in return. That cannot happen if you don't plan to get those players in free agency. The farm system is completely barren with superstar future talent, particularly in the pitching area. The well has dried up and the future aint all that bright right now.
